Small aircraft crashes near Vehari; pilots safe
Share on WhatAppShare on XShare on Facebook

Vehari, April 15, 2025: A light aircraft crashed near the Ratta Tibba area in Punjab’s Vehari district on Tuesday, but fortunately, no casualties were reported.

According to local authorities, the aircraft went down near Anwar Abad. Both pilots on board managed to eject and parachute to safety before the crash. Police confirmed that neither pilot sustained injuries.

The cause of the crash has not yet been determined. Authorities have launched an investigation to examine potential technical faults or operational issues that may have led to the incident.

Emergency response teams were promptly dispatched to the site, and the area has been cordoned off for further assessment. This marks the second such incident involving a light aircraft in the region in recent weeks, raising concerns over aviation safety standards and aircraft maintenance practices in the private sector.
